Alpha HPA (A4N) Q4 2025 TU earnings summary

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.

Logotype for Alpha HPA Limited

Q4 2025 TU earnings summary

28 Jul, 2025

Executive summary

  • Major civil works and offsite fabrication commenced for HPA First Project Stage 2, targeting the world's largest single-site high purity aluminium facility.

  • Product marketing focused on semiconductor sector, with 390 test and sales orders since May 2024 and strong demand from AI/data centre and power-semiconductor growth.

  • Stage 1 production fully utilised, focusing on high purity Al-Nitrates, ATH, and HPA tablets, with expansion options under review to meet rising demand.

  • Alpha Sapphire recorded first sapphire wafer sales for semiconductor qualification and committed remaining 2025 production to optics customers.

Financial highlights

  • Product sales for the quarter totaled AUD $114,014, with a weighted average unit price of USD $24.37.

  • Open sales orders at quarter end valued at USD $193,988, with a weighted average unit price of USD $27.31.

  • Receipts from customers were $114,000 for the quarter, with net cash used in operating activities at $(9.45) million.

  • Cash and cash equivalents at quarter end were $102.3 million, down from $119.9 million in the previous quarter.

  • Estimated quarters of funding available is 10.83 based on current cash burn.

Outlook and guidance

  • LOI coverage secured for ~62% of Stage 2 production capacity, with further LOIs under negotiation and significant volume expansions expected.

  • Stage 1 facility fully booked through June 2025, with customer requests exceeding current production capacity.

  • Minor capital program initiated to establish in-house nano alumina slurry capability, targeting delivery from February 2026.

  • Alpha Polaris project in Canada advancing through concept study phase, driven by high demand forecasts in semiconductor and lithium extraction sectors.
